Negative and fractional indices represent a sophisticated extension of exponential mathematics that challenges students to think beyond whole number powers. These comprehensive presentations available through Wayground provide structured instruction that demystifies complex exponential concepts through clear visual learning and systematic concept explanation. Students develop critical mathematical reasoning skills as they explore how negative exponents relate to reciprocals and division, while fractional indices connect exponential notation to radical expressions and nth roots. The presentations guide learners through essential skills including simplifying expressions with negative exponents, converting between exponential and radical forms, and applying the fundamental laws of indices to complex mathematical problems involving both negative and fractional powers.
